Abstract

PURPOSE: A pontoon structure for an indoor golf practice ranger is provided to shorten a period of construction, to reduce construction expenses and to simplify maintenance works for facilities. CONSTITUTION: The pontoon structure for an indoor golf practice ranger comprises: a column pontoon(1) provided with a hanger(4) to couple a net(3) on both sides, a hook(5) for hanging up the hanger(4) and the net(3), and gas injection parts for charging with helium gas; a roof pontoon(2) located on the column pontoon(1) and provided with a gas injection part, a hanger(11) for a net(3) formed downward, and a connecting hook(13) for fixing the roof pontoon(2) on the ground by a rope(12); a net(3) connected between the pontoons(1,2); an anchor(14) installed on the ground correspondingly to the connecting hook(13) of the roof pontoon(2); and a gas supply system for charging up high-pressure gas to each pontoon(1,2).
